Linear Demand Curve

A graphical representation showing a straight-line relationship between the price of a good and the quantity demanded.

Quasi-Fixed Costs

Costs that are not directly tied to the level of production or output, such as salaries or rent, which remain somewhat constant until a significant change in operations occurs.

Total Cost Function

A mathematical expression that calculates the total cost of producing a given level of output, incorporating both fixed and variable costs.
